Applications
Felbamate (CAS 25451-15-4) is a small-molecule pharmaceutical active ingredient used in prescription anticonvulsant medications; in medicinal chemistry it serves as a building block for the synthesis of related carbamate-containing compounds; it is also encountered as a reference material for analytical method development and quality control in pharmaceutical settings; and it is supplied as a fine chemical intermediate for custom synthesis and process development in the pharma and chemical industries.
